技术领域:Technical field:
本实用新型涉及灯具技术领域,尤其涉及一种扁平LED感应灯。The utility model relates to the technical field of lamps, in particular to a flat LED induction lamp.
背景技术:Background technique:
目前,灯具不仅仅起到照明作用,更多的时候它起到的是装饰作用。灯具作为装饰物时,不仅能给较为单调的色彩和造型增加新的内容,同时还可以通过调整灯具的规格、安装位置、造型变化、灯光强弱等手段,达到烘托气氛、改变建筑结构感觉的作用,往往成为建筑装修中的点睛之笔。At present, lamps and lanterns not only play a lighting role, but more often they play a decorative role. When lamps are used as decorations, they can not only add new content to relatively monotonous colors and shapes, but also achieve the effect of setting off the atmosphere and changing the feeling of architectural structure by adjusting the specifications, installation positions, shape changes, and light intensity of lamps and other means. Function, often become the finishing touch in architectural decoration.
灯具的种类繁多,造型千变万化,其中一种常用的灯具为自动感应LED灯。自动感应LED灯是因应节能环保要求而研发生产的新型节能照明电器产品,其性能满足自动、高效节能的要求,光源采用LED即发光二极管,具有寿命长、亮度高、功率小、节能效果显著的特点。现有的自动感应LED灯,其造型一般是曲面形状的,产品造型不够独特,难以迎合消费者多元化的需求。There are many kinds of lamps and lanterns, and their shapes are ever-changing. One of the commonly used lamps is an automatic induction LED lamp. Automatic induction LED lamp is a new type of energy-saving lighting electrical product developed and produced in response to energy-saving and environmental protection requirements. Its performance meets the requirements of automatic, high-efficiency and energy-saving. features. The existing auto-sensing LED lamps generally have a curved surface shape, and the product shape is not unique enough to meet the diversified needs of consumers.
实用新型内容:Utility model content:
本实用新型的目的在于针对现有技术的不足,提供一种扁平LED感应灯,该LED感应灯整体呈扁平方形,造型与扁平数码相机相似,具有产品造型独特的特点,有利于迎合消费者多元化的需求。The purpose of this utility model is to provide a flat LED induction lamp for the deficiencies of the prior art. The LED induction lamp is flat and square as a whole, and its shape is similar to that of a flat digital camera. needs.
为实现上述目的,本实用新型通过以下技术方案实现:一种扁平LED感应灯,它包括灯壳,灯壳内设置有LED灯,所述灯壳呈扁平方形,灯壳的正面设置有与LED灯匹配的透明片,灯壳的正面还设置有感应器,所述透明片呈方形。In order to achieve the above purpose, the utility model is realized through the following technical solutions: a flat LED induction lamp, which includes a lamp housing, an LED lamp is arranged inside the lamp housing, the lamp housing is flat and square, and the front of the lamp housing is provided with an LED A transparent sheet matching the lamp, and a sensor is also arranged on the front of the lamp housing, and the transparent sheet is square.
所述感应器呈圆形。The sensor is circular.
所述透明片设置于灯壳的正面的右部,所述感应器设置于灯壳的正面左上部。The transparent sheet is arranged on the right side of the front of the lamp housing, and the sensor is arranged on the upper left of the front of the lamp housing.
所述灯壳还设置有挂钩。The lamp housing is also provided with a hook.
所述挂钩设置于灯壳的背面,挂钩与灯壳铰接。The hook is arranged on the back of the lamp housing, and the hook is hinged with the lamp housing.
所述灯壳的背面开设有与挂钩匹配的凹槽,挂钩可嵌入所述凹槽。A groove matching the hook is provided on the back of the lamp housing, and the hook can be inserted into the groove.
还包括档位开关,档位开关设置于灯壳的上端面。A gear switch is also included, and the gear switch is arranged on the upper surface of the lamp housing.
所述灯壳的侧端开设有穿绳孔。The side end of the lamp housing is provided with a threading hole.
所述透明片为玻璃片。The transparent sheet is a glass sheet.
本实用新型有益效果为:本实用新型所述一种扁平LED感应灯,它包括灯壳,灯壳内设置有LED灯,所述灯壳呈扁平方形,灯壳的正面设置有与LED灯匹配的透明片,灯壳的正面还设置有感应器,所述透明片呈方形。采用上述结构的LED感应灯,其整体呈扁平方形,造型与扁平数码相机相似,具有产品造型独特的特点,有利于迎合消费者多元化的需求。The beneficial effects of the utility model are: a flat LED induction lamp described in the utility model, which includes a lamp housing, an LED lamp is arranged inside the lamp housing, the lamp housing is flat and square, and the front of the lamp housing is provided with a The transparent sheet is provided with a sensor on the front of the lamp housing, and the transparent sheet is square. The LED induction lamp adopting the above-mentioned structure has a flat square shape as a whole, and its shape is similar to that of a flat digital camera.

作为优选的实施方式,所述感应器3呈圆形,所述透明片2设置于灯壳1的正面的右部,所述感应器3设置于灯壳1的正面左上部,所述档位开关4设置于灯壳1的上端面。该结构的LED感应灯,其整体呈扁平方形,其中灯壳1、透明片2、感应器3和档位开关4的整体结合,使得该LED感应灯的产品造型与扁平数码相机相似,具有产品造型独特的特点,有利于迎合消费者多元化的需求。As a preferred embodiment, the
作为优选的实施方式,所述灯壳1还设置有挂钩6,挂钩6的作用是,可将LED感应灯挂起来进行照明,丰富了LED感应灯的放置方式,适应性更广。进一步的,所述挂钩6设置于灯壳1的背面,挂钩6与灯壳1铰接,即挂钩6可旋转,使用时可根据不同的放置位置来旋转挂钩6。更进一步的,所述灯壳1的背面开设有与挂钩6匹配的凹槽,转动挂钩6时挂钩6可嵌入所述凹槽,不使用挂钩6时,可将挂钩6嵌入凹槽内,从而不影响外观。As a preferred embodiment, the
作为优选的实施方式,所述灯壳1的侧端开设有穿绳孔5,穿绳孔5可用于穿设绳子,方便使用者携带。As a preferred embodiment, the side end of the
